Potato chips plus chocolate - combined to make cookies - equals a winning treat.
Makes 2 to 3 dozen Prep Time 20 minutes Baking Time 10 to 12 minutes
1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
3/4 cup butter
1/2 cup sugar
3/4 cup brown sugar
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up semisweet chocolate chips
2 cups crushed potato chips
3/4 cup melted chocolate for dipping
1 Preheat oven to 350ºF.
2 Sift together flour and baking soda; set aside.
3 In another bowl, cream butter and sugars. Beat in egg and vanilla until well incorporated.
4 Mix in flour until just incorporated; do not overmix.
5 Fold in chocolate chips and crushed potato chips.
6 Bake for 10 to 12 minutes or until light brown in color.
7 Cool and dip half of each cookie into the melted chocolate. Cool in the chiller for 5 to 10 minutes or until chocolate has set.
